What is roof integrated solar?

Just before we dive into the benefits of this innovation, we think it’s important to explain what roof integrated solar is. They are panels that replace the tiles or slates on a roof panel, which makes the solar installation look like more of a natural integration into the roof. Traditional solar panels often look like a clumsy add on to properties, while an integrated solar roof is much more aesthetically pleasing. The benefits of roof integrated solar

Maintenance

In most domestic settings, solar panels have a lifespan of approximately thirty years. After this time, you will probably need to replace or at least repair the panels that you have used for the past few decades. If you have a standard solar panel installation at your property, you will need to remove all of the panels before one of them can be replaced, as there are tiles behind the panels. However, with roof integrated solar, there are no tiles or slates behind the solar panels, meaning you can easily remove and replace individual panels, or even carry out ongoing repairs with relative ease. 

Installation

There are strict industry regulations in regards to the fixing of solar panels to roofs on exiting buildings. In other words, attaching an above-roof solar system is far from easy. The installation team will probably need to crack some tiles to fix the panels to your roof, and attach the necessary holding brackets to keep the system in place. In stark contrast, roof integrated panels have been designed to fit seamlessly into a new roof. Specialist solar installers can slide the panels into the roof without delay, and it doesn’t require any uplifting of current tiles or slates. Therefore, not only are roof integrated solar systems easier to maintain, they’re actually easier to fit in the first place. 

Fewer issues with nesting birds

When standard solar panels are fixed atop a roof, they provide a safe area for birds to shelter and build their nests. Although having birds around your home isn’t necessarily a bad thing, when they’re nesting around your solar panels they can increase the amount of maintenance required as far as cleaning the panels is concerned, and has even led some people to pay for technicians to come and make their solar panels bird proof. With roof integrated solar, there is no place for birds to get in behind the panels, meaning you’re unlikely to encounter this problem in the first place.
